Oldham 1-1 Tranmere
E-mail your reaction to Football Talk
A superb strike by Cristian Colusso salvaged a point for Oldham in a hard-fought draw between two sides battling for promotion. It was Tranmere who opened the scoring in the 12th minute, Paul Rideout converting his fifth goal of the campaign. Rovers goalkeeper John Achterberg then made a couple of fine saves to deny David Eyres and Paul Murray. But Tranmere have not beaten Oldham in three meetings this season, and sure enough the diminutive Colusso equalised in the 59th minute with his first goal for the club.
Oldham: Rachubka, McNiven, Baudet, Balmer, Armstrong, Murray, Appleby, Colusso, Eyres, Reeves, Smart. Subs: Kelly, Holden, Rickers, Corazzin, Hardy. Tranmere: Achterberg, Yates, Allen, Hill, Roberts, Navarro, Mellon, Henry, Koumas, Rideout, Price. Subs: Parkinson, Murphy, Barlow, Allison, Hinds. Referee: N Barry (Scunthorpe). |
